  2. tropadise

    Recipe in grams:

    – 200 cream
    – 300 milk
    – 100 Pistachio paste
    – 102 honey
    – 50 Corn syrup
    – 14 malt powder
    – 50 grams milk powder
    – 1/2 tsp salt

    Combine everything, heat to dissolve sugars and honey, immersion blend well. Chill and churn.

    Mix-Ins:
    – Honey cookie chunks (Preppy Kitchen recipe)
    – Blueberry swirl (215 grams blueberries, 85 grams sugar, 50 grams corn syrup, 1/4 tsp salt, half a lemon. Combine all this in a pot and set on high heat. Reduce mixture by 100 grams before chilling.)
